>> Earlier in the docbuilding, I see this:
>>
>> [combinat ] building [inventory]: targets for 2 source files that are out
>> of date
>> [combinat ] updating environment: 0 added, 2 changed, 0 removed
>> [combinat ] reading sources... [ 50%]
>> sage/combinat/cluster_algebra_quiver/cluster_seed
>> [combinat ] Encoding error:
>> [combinat ] 'ascii' codec can't decode byte 0xc3 in position 414: ordinal
>> not in range(128)
>> [combinat ] The full traceback has been saved in
>> /var/folders/cp/n8wtqs490tq5psknff1hv9qr0000gn/T/sphinx-err-jeDhGW.log, if
>> you want to report the issue to the developers.
>>
>> which is caused by the accents on line 18 of cluster_seed.py. Does the
>> problem go away if you remove those accents or add something like
>>
>> # -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
>>
>> to the top of the file?
